Job Description Summary
The Executive Assistant III provides advanced administrative, operational, and executive support to senior leadership within the Office of Communications and Marketing. This position supports the OCM leadership, including executive leadership, and exercises independent judgment in managing complex schedules, confidential matters, executive communications, and departmental priorities. The position also helps with administrative and operational tasks enabling execution of MUSC’s construction events and marketing sponsorships. The role functions as a primary administrative and communications hub for OCM, supporting operations, human resources coordination, financial and contract administration, and enterprise-wide engagement. The Executive Assistant III operates with a high degree of discretion, autonomy and proactive thought.Entity

Job Description
The Executive Assistant III performs senior-level administrative work requiring an understanding of departmental operations, MUSC enterprise policies, and executive protocols. Responsibilities include calendar management, meeting coordination, correspondence, travel, document preparation, relationship management, and project coordination for executive leaders.
This role interfaces regularly with MUSC leadership, the Board of Trustees, partners across the enterprise, and external stakeholders to ensure communications and activities are managed accurately, professionally, and in alignment with institutional policies.
In addition to executive and departmental support responsibilities, this position provides administrative and operational support for MUSC's enterprise events, including construction milestones and other high-profile institutional engagements. Responsibilities include coordinating logistics and executing on event planning project plans. The teammate will also support administrative execution of our sponsorships with external organizations.
Principal Accountabilities
50% – Event and Sponsorship Administrative and Operational Support
Provides administrative and operational support for MUSC-hosted construction events, groundbreaking ceremonies, ribbon cuttings, donor recognition events, and other enterprise events.
Coordinates event logistics, including venue reservations, catering, audiovisual services, signage, supplies, parking arrangements, attendee tracking, and day-of-event administrative support.
Assists with the development and maintenance of event timelines, task lists, run-of-show documents, guest lists, invitations, RSVPs, and event materials.
Maintains sponsorship records, agreements, invoices, payment documentation, benefit tracking, and related administrative files.
Coordinates administrative processes associated with sponsorship requests, approvals, contract routing, renewals, reporting, and documentation.
30% – Chief and Executive Administrative Support
Establishes, manages, and prioritizes the Chief’s complex calendar; evaluates and routes meeting requests using independent judgment.
Provides scheduling, meeting coordination, and follow-up support for the Deputy Chief the Executive Director team.
Assists with leadership travel arrangements and expense report submissions.
Coordinates leadership team and departmental meetings, retreats, and activities to ensure efficient execution.
Initiates meetings and coordinates agendas, materials, and participants for executive and enterprise engagements.
Arranges and manages executive travel and meetings; prepares and submits expense reports in Workday.
Maintains confidential executive files, records, and documentation.
Directs and manages special projects as assigned by the Chief.
15% – Departmental Support
Receives, screens, and responds to incoming correspondence, calls, and visitors; resolves inquiries or refers matters as appropriate.
Manages administrative issues and inquiries requiring coordination across departments.
Supports recruitment and workforce administration activities, including job postings, Classification & Compensation review coordination, Labor Committee approvals, onboarding, offboarding, and reclassifications.
Assists with timekeeping administration, personnel actions, and departmental communications.
Plans and coordinates OCM‑led events, including securing venues, catering, AV and event services, agendas, materials, and coordination with external speakers and guests.
Manages supply orders for the department and office.
